Where This Design Shines and Where to Be Cautious
The Mini Dachshund Dog Embroidery Designs perform exceptionally well on flat, non-stretchy fabrics such as t-shirts, tote bags, and aprons. They are particularly suited for custom apparel and sweatshirt embroidery where the design can be centered or positioned strategically for visual balance.
However, when working with small hoop sizes, textured fabrics, or thin materials, extra attention is needed. The design may require additional stabilizer to prevent puckering, especially on stretchy or woven fabrics. Also, on curved surfaces like caps or hats, the design might need slight modifications to align properly with the contour.
For commercial embroidery or craft business use, consider how this design will look across various printable mockups and digital embroidery files. It’s important to confirm whether the embroidery file includes all necessary stitch types—like satin stitch for outlines and fill stitch for details—to ensure consistency in finished products.

Embroidery Designer Notes: Tips for Using the Mini Dachshund Design
Before committing to a full project, test the Mini Dachshund Dog Embroidery Designs on scrap fabric to evaluate how the stitch density interacts with different fabrics. Check the thread colors against your chosen background to ensure the design remains visible and vibrant.
Review the hoop size required to accommodate the entire design, and consider whether you’ll need to divide the design into sections for larger projects. Inspect small details closely, especially if planning to use the design on tiny lettering or dense stitch areas.
Testing the design in black and white mockups can help identify potential issues with contrast and clarity. Also, comparing the design on both light and dark fabric backgrounds ensures it works well across a range of handmade products and personalized gifts.
Finally, make sure to use the appropriate stabilizer for your fabric type and consider how the design will hold up after repeated washing, especially for items like pillow covers or kitchen towels.
